ACP Antony Moses (Prithviraj Sukumaran) tracks down a killer but loses his memory in a car accident right before he can reveal the name. He is forced to solve the case all over again while struggling with his lost identity.

It is widely considered one of the best psychological thrillers in Indian cinema due to its layered writing and shocking climax.

Regional cinema has been a staple of Indian filmmaking for decades, with various regions producing high-quality films that cater to local audiences. However, in recent years, regional cinema has gained a pan-India appeal, with films from languages like Tamil, Telugu, Malayalam, and Kannada becoming increasingly popular across the country.
